  • Sir Paul McCartney performed two intimate shows at the Fonda Theater in Hollywood, following the announcement of his new album, The Boys of Dungeon Lane.
  • During one of the concerts, McCartney reportedly made a jibe at Donald Trump's dance moves, which led to boos from the audience when Trump's name was mentioned.
  • The star-studded events were attended by numerous celebrities, including Stevie Nicks, Taylor Swift, Billie Eilish, Margot Robbie, and his former bandmate Ringo Starr.
  • Fans expressed that the concerts served as a much-needed relief from the current political climate, offering a sense of community and upliftment.
  • McCartney's upcoming album, The Boys of Dungeon Lane, set for release on 29 May, is inspired by his memories of growing up in post-war Liverpool.
